In the mid-1960s through the early 1970s, the construction industry in Colorado underwent a significant shift. During this period, the price of copper skyrocketed, leading many builders in expanding neighborhoods like Cherry Creek and Aurora to turn to aluminum wiring as a cost-effective alternative. At the time, it seemed like a brilliant solution to meet the demands of a booming housing market. However, as technology advances and our home power needs grow, we’ve discovered that these systems simply can't keep up with the demands of 21st-century living.

Why Aluminum Wiring Poses a Modern Risk

Understanding the "why" behind electrical risks is essential before discussing the "what" of remediation. While the aluminum wire itself isn't necessarily dangerous while sitting undisturbed in a wall, its physical properties create significant hazards at every connection point: outlets, switches, and the breaker panel.

The primary challenge is that aluminum and copper behave very differently under the stress of daily use. We have found that aluminum is much more susceptible to the following issues:

  • Thermal Expansion: Aluminum expands and contracts significantly more than copper when electricity flows through it. This "creeping" motion causes connections to loosen over time.
  • Oxidation: When aluminum is exposed to air, it forms a layer of aluminum oxide. Unlike copper oxide, which is still conductive, aluminum oxide is an insulator that resists the flow of electricity, generating intense heat.
  • Galvanic Corrosion: When aluminum is connected to traditional brass or copper terminals (which were common in 1960s-70s devices), a chemical reaction occurs that further degrades the connection.
  • Malleability: Aluminum is a softer metal. It is easily nicked or crushed during installation, creating "hot spots" where the wire is thinner and more likely to overheat.

If you are living in a home built between 1965 and 1973 in the Denver metro area, your property may be up to 55 times more likely to experience a fire hazard at a wire connection compared to a home with copper wiring. Recognizing the Warning Signs in Your Home

We believe in empowering our customers with knowledge so they can act before a minor issue becomes a major catastrophe. If you own an older home in Aurora or Cherry Creek, it is vital to stay vigilant. Outdated systems often give subtle warnings before they fail completely.

As your dedicated electrician in Denver, we recommend keeping an eye out for these red flags:

  • Warm Cover Plates: If your light switches or outlet covers feel warm to the touch, it indicates that heat is building up behind the wall.
  • Flickering Lights: Frequent flickering that isn't related to a storm or a utility outage often points to a loose aluminum connection.
  • Strange Odors: A distinct smell of burning plastic or a "fishy" chemical scent near an outlet is a sign that the insulation is melting.
  • Discoloration: Look for any yellowing, browning, or soot-like marks on the face of your outlets or switches.
  • Audible Noises: Buzzing, popping, or sizzling sounds coming from your walls are indicators of "arcing," where electricity is jumping across a loose gap.

If you notice any of these symptoms, do not attempt a DIY fix. Because aluminum is brittle and sensitive to torque, disturbing these connections can actually increase the risk of a fire. Instead, consult a professional electrician in Aurora, CO to perform a comprehensive inspection.

There are three primary ways we handle aluminum wiring remediation:

  1. Full Copper Rewire: This is the gold standard of electrical safety. We remove all existing aluminum branch-circuit wiring and replace it with high-quality copper. While this is the most involved process, it completely eliminates the risk associated with aluminum and significantly increases your home's resale value and insurability.
  2. COPALUM Crimp Remediation: This is a CPSC-approved permanent repair. We use a specialized high-pressure crimping tool to join a small "pigtail" of copper wire to the existing aluminum wire. This creates a gas-tight, permanent bond that prevents oxidation and loosening.
  3. AlumiConn Connectors: These are specially designed lugs that allow for the safe transition from aluminum to copper. They are an excellent, cost-effective alternative to a full rewire when performed by a certified professional who understands the specific torque requirements for these connectors.

The Denver real estate market is highly competitive, and home buyers today are more educated than ever. Aluminum wiring is often a major "red flag" during a home inspection, potentially leading to lost sales or heavy credits at the closing table.
